Once the tea bag has steeped, remove it … WebOct 11, 2024 · To use a tea bag for a toothache, start by boiling water and steeping the tea bag in the hot water for 3-5 minutes. Once the tea bag has steeped, remove it from the water and allow it to cool slightly. Then, place the tea bag on the affected tooth and bite down gently to hold it in place. Ease Tooth Pain 5 /10 If... porterhouse palladiumWebFor temporary relief of a toothache, you can do the following: Rinse with warm saltwater. Saltwater can loosen debris between your teeth, act as a disinfectant and reduce inflammation. Stir a ½ teaspoon of salt into a glass of warm water and rinse your mouth thoroughly.
